Maggie Sansone
  1. Early Life and Musical Background: Maggie Sansone is an American hammered dulcimer player and recording artist known for her innovative interpretations of traditional Celtic music. Born and raised in Maryland, Sansone developed a deep appreciation for folk music from an early age, inspired by her family's Irish and Scottish heritage. She began playing the hammered dulcimer in her teens and quickly honed her skills, eventually becoming one of the instrument's most accomplished practitioners.

  2. Exploration of Celtic Music: Sansone's passion for Celtic music led her to immerse herself in the rich traditions of Ireland, Scotland, and other Celtic regions. She traveled extensively, studying with renowned musicians and delving into the nuances of Celtic melodies and rhythms. Sansone's dedication to authenticity and reverence for the music's heritage are evident in her heartfelt interpretations and meticulous attention to detail.

  3. Innovative Approach to the Hammered Dulcimer: Maggie Sansone is celebrated for her innovative approach to the hammered dulcimer, a stringed instrument with origins dating back centuries. She blends traditional Celtic tunes with contemporary arrangements, incorporating elements of jazz, world music, and even electronic instrumentation to create a uniquely modern sound. Sansone's skillful use of the hammered dulcimer's rich timbres and dynamic range showcases the instrument's versatility and expressive potential.

  4. Recording Career and Collaborations: Throughout her career, Maggie Sansone has released numerous albums that showcase her mastery of the hammered dulcimer and her deep connection to Celtic music. She has collaborated with esteemed musicians from both the Celtic and contemporary music worlds, including renowned flutist Bonnie Rideout and guitarist Al Petteway. Sansone's recordings have earned critical acclaim and have garnered a dedicated following among fans of Celtic and folk music.

  5. Educator and Advocate: In addition to her work as a performer and recording artist, Maggie Sansone is also a dedicated educator and advocate for Celtic music and culture. She conducts workshops, masterclasses, and educational programs to share her knowledge and passion for the hammered dulcimer and Celtic traditions with aspiring musicians and enthusiasts. Sansone's efforts to preserve and promote Celtic music ensure that its legacy will continue to thrive for generations to come.
